Bacon Cheese Butternut Rotini


  • Author: Cristina Curp
  • Prep Time: 5
  • Cook Time: 25
  • Total Time: 35
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x
  • Category: Side Dish
  • Method: Stove Top
  • Cuisine: Italian

Description

Delicious pasta like meal made with loads of veggies!


Scale

Ingredients

“Pasta”

  • 2 bags Mann’s Butternut Squash Rotini
  • 5 slices bacon
  • 4 cloves garlic
  • 1 tsp salt

Sauce

  • 1 cup cauliflower florets ( or ¾ cup raw cashews)
  • 6 ounces bone both
  • 2 tablespoons nutritional yeast
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on dried Italian herbs
  • 1 tablespoon pastured gelatin

Instructions

  1. Spread the rotini on a sheet pan. Top with chopped bacon.
  2. Sprinkle with minced garlic and salt.
  3. Roast at 400F for 25 minutes.
  4. In the meantime, simmer the cauliflower (or cashews) in the broth until tender.
  5. Transfer everything to a blender, add in the vinegar, herbs and gelatin and blend until smooth.
  6. When the rotini is done, remove it from the oven, scrape it up off of the sheet pan and toss in a bowl with 2 tablespoons to ¼ cup of cheese sauce.
  7. Serve, share, enjoy!
